Manages and matures our identity security posture - executes continuously monitoring and remediating identity risk and access exposure across IAM/IGA/PAM - reducing breach likelihood and audit/compliance risk. The Identity Security Posture Management (ISPM) Specialist is responsible for improving the organization’s identity security posture by continuously identifying, prioritizing, and driving remediation of identity-related exposures across the enterprise. This role partners with Account Operations, IGA, PAM, Cybersecurity Operations, IT infrastructure, and application owners to reduce identity attack paths, strengthen privileged access controls, and produce measurable risk reduction aligned to regulatory and audit expectations

Responsibilities:
  • Identity posture monitoring & exposure management
  • Operate and mature the Identity Security Posture Management capability (ISPM) to discover identity exposures across Identity Providers (e.g., Entra ID/AD), SaaS applications, cloud environments, and critical business systems.
  • Identify and track identity security issues such as excessive privileges, dormant accounts, misconfigured admin roles, weak authentication enforcement, privilege escalation paths, and risky third-party access.
  • Maintain an Identity Exposure Register with severity, business impact, owner, remediation plan, and due dates; enforce SLA-based remediation for critical findings.
  • Risk prioritization & remediation orchestration
  • Triage and prioritize findings using risk-based methods (e.g., likelihood/impact, exploitability, business criticality).
  • Coordinate remediation with system owners: role redesign, least privilege enforcement, MFA coverage improvements, privileged role controls, conditional access, and entitlement clean-up.
  • Drive reduction of inappropriate combinations and segmentation-of-duties issues where relevant.
  • Controls, audit, and compliance enablement
  • Provide evidence to support identity-related controls (e.g., privileged access governance, MFA enforcement, access review/UAR posture, joiner-mover-leaver quality, service account governance).
  • Produce audit-ready reporting and artifacts for internal audit and external auditors (SOX/ITGC/GITC reliance, regulator exams).
  • Ensure posture findings are connected to policy/standard requirements and tracked through governance workflows.
  • Telemetry, metrics, and executive reporting
  • Build and maintain ISPM dashboards and KRIs (e.g., privileged role sprawl, stale privileged accounts, MFA coverage, high-risk entitlements, remediation cycle time).
  • Present posture trends and remediation progress to Identity Security & Governance leadership and stakeholders (CISO org, IT, app owners).
  • Integration & automation
  • Partner with engineering teams to integrate ISPM insights with ticketing/workflow tools (e.g., Axonius, ServiceNow/Jira), SIEM/SOAR, IGA (e.g., SailPoint), and PAM (e.g., CyberArk).
  • Automate repeatable posture checks where possible (APIs, scripts, scheduled reports), and document repeatable playbooks/runbooks.
  • Collaboration & stakeholder enablement
  • Act as a trusted advisor to application and infrastructure teams on identity security best practices (least privilege, role design, privileged access, authentication hardening).
  • Contribute to identity governance operating procedures, playbooks, and standard updates.

  • 5+ years in identity security, IAM/IGA, security operations, or security risk management with hands-on exposure to identity platforms.
  • Working knowledge of identity concepts: authentication, authorization, RBAC/ABAC, privileged access, service accounts, identity lifecycle, entitlement models, and access reviews.
  • Experience interpreting identity-related findings and coordinating remediation with technical and business stakeholders.
  • Familiarity with at least two of the following areas: Entra ID/Azure AD, Active Directory, SailPoint (or equivalent IGA), CyberArk (or equivalent PAM), AWS/Azure identity constructs, common SaaS admin models.
  • Strong documentation and reporting skills (evidence packs, dashboards, executive-ready summaries).
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ience with ISPM/identity exposure tooling (identity threat detection, entitlement risk, posture management, attack path analysis).
  • Experience in regulated industries (insurance, financial services, healthcare) and audit support (SOX/ITGC, NYDFS, GLBA). Practical automation skills (PowerShell, Python, KQL, APIs) to streamline posture checks and reporting.
  • Certifications (nice to have): Security+, SSCP, CISSP (or associate), GIAC IAM-related, Microsoft/AWS security certifications.
